Unsolved
This post is more than 5 years old
13 Posts
0
27243
March 2nd, 2006 15:00
5324 problem - SWINIT-F-INITPORTLIB: SW2C_dist_new_master_id:: Port lib init failed
When I power on my switch, I get the following error message:
SWINIT-F-INITPORTLIB: SW2C_dist_new_master_id:: Port lib init failed
Is there anything that I can do to fix the switch or perform some sort of reset function?
Thank you,
Frank
No Events found!


DELL-Cuong N.
1K Posts
0
March 3rd, 2006 17:00
This message is very strange. Does it happens pretty much when the switch first boots - maybe you can post all the stuff that goes before this message when it boots? This message makes me think that either the FW image is bad or perhaps the wrong FW image is loaded onto this switch. Maybe you will be able to fix this by using xmodem method to reload the FW image for this 5324 switch.
Here is the section the doc on how to use xmodem:
<ADMIN NOTE: Broken link has been removed from this post by Dell>
See the section on "Software Download" after going to this link.
Cuong.
DELL-Cuong N.
1K Posts
0
March 3rd, 2006 18:00
Is there anything configure on these switches? Anything connected to them? I'll send a question to some of my colleague to see if anyone recognize this error message. I'll let you know.
Cuong.
blue-dot
13 Posts
0
March 3rd, 2006 18:00
blue-dot
13 Posts
0
March 3rd, 2006 18:00
------ Performing the Power-On Self Test (POST) ------
UART Channel Loopback Test........................PASS
Testing the System SDRAM..........................PASS
Boot1 Checksum Test...............................PASS
Boot2 Checksum Test...............................PASS
Flash Image Validation Test.......................PASS
BOOT Software Version 1.0.0.21 Built 10-Aug-2004 13:33:06
##
########### ##### ###### ######
############## ######### ###### ######
############### ######### ###### ######
################ ########## #### ###### ######
################ ######### ###### ###### ######
######################## ######### ###### ######
###### ############## ######## ####### ######
###### ###################### ######### ######
###### #################### ########## ######
###### ################### ########### ######
###### ################## ############# ######
###### ################################# ######
################################################# ############
################ ################ ############# ############
################ ############## ############# ############
############### ########## ############# ############
############## ######## ############# ############
########### #### ############# ############
##
PowerConnect 5324 board based on FireFox 88E6218 ARM946E-S processor
64 MByte SDRAM. I-Cache 8 KB. D-Cache 8 KB. Cache Enabled.
Autoboot in 2 seconds - press RETURN or Esc. to abort and enter prom.
Preparing to decompress...
Decompressing SW from image-1
7a8c80
OK
Running from RAM...
*********************************************************************
*** Running SW Ver. 1.0.0.45 Date 07-Jun-2004 Time 14:34:51 ***
*********************************************************************
HW version is 00.00.02
Base Mac address is: 00:11:43:9b:0d:80
Dram size is : 64M bytes
Dram first block size is : 40960K bytes
Dram first PTR is : 0x1800000
Flash size is: 16M
Loading running configuration.
Number of configuration items loaded: 0
Loading startup configuration.
Number of configuration items loaded: 0
Device configuration:
Prestera based system
Slot 1 - powerConnect 5324 HW Rev. 0.0
01-Jan-2000 01:01:22 %2SWINIT-F-INITPORTLIB: SW2C_dist_new_master_id:: Port lib
init failed
***** FATAL ERROR *****
Reporting Task: ROOT.
Software Version: 1.0.0.45 (date 07-Jun-2004 time 14:34:51)
blue-dot
13 Posts
0
March 3rd, 2006 20:00
How do I erase the entire flash to start fresh?
DELL-Cuong N.
1K Posts
0
March 3rd, 2006 20:00
DELL-Cuong N.
1K Posts
0
March 3rd, 2006 20:00
blue-dot
13 Posts
0
March 3rd, 2006 20:00
blue-dot
13 Posts
0
March 4th, 2006 19:00
There must be someone at Dell that knows and can explain what this error means. As you can see from the previous screen capture, all of the initial tests PASS for the switch.
Please assist.
DELL-Cuong N.
1K Posts
0
March 6th, 2006 13:00
I'm forwarding question to development team who worked on this switch. We'll let you know.
Cuong.
DELL-Cuong N.
1K Posts
0
March 9th, 2006 13:00
I have spoken to development team on this issue, they have some follow up questions:
Thanks,
Cuong.
JGirardNRG
1 Message
0
October 9th, 2006 20:00
*** Running SW Ver. 1.0.0.47 Date 02-Nov-2005 Time 09:53:18 ***
*********************************************************************
Base Mac address is: 00:11:43:9b:3f:50
Dram size is : 64M bytes
Dram first block size is : 40960K bytes
Dram first PTR is : 0x1800000
Flash size is: 16M
Loading running configuration.
Number of configuration items loaded: 0
Number of configuration items loaded: 0
BOXP_full_system_scan - BOXP_convert_unit_num_to_unit_index: unit_num =1, lcl_unit_idx=0
BOXP_smi_scan_on_slot - ENTRY - unit_num= 1, slot_num= 1
BOXP_smi_scan_on_slot - BOXP_convert_unit_num_to_unit_index - unit_num= 1, unit_idx= 0
BOXP_smi_scan_on_slot - update unit_idx= 0
BOXP_smi_scan_on_slot - BOXP_get_slot_info - unit_num= 1, unit_idx= 0
BOXP_smi_scan_on_slot - read slot_PTR
$$$$ slot_state =0
$$$$ slot_number =1
$$$$ unit_number =0
$$$$ pci_bus_id =16
$$$$ conn_module =1
BOXP_smi_scan_on_slot - BOXP_set_module_db: - unit_num=1, slot_num=1, mod_type=1
BOXP_smi_scan_on_slot - BOXP_update_system_dbs OK - unit_num =1,slot_num=1
BOXP_full_system_scan - BOXP_smi_scan_on_slot - OK
BOXP_full_system_scan - BOXP_get_slot_info: lcl_unit_idx= 0, slot_idx= 0
BOXP_full_system_scan - BOXP_update_module_env_tbls: unit_num= 1, slot_num= 1
BOXP_full_system_scan - BOXP_update_unit_env_tbls: unit_num= 1Device configuration:
Prestera based system
Slot 1 - powerConnect 5324 HW Rev. 0.0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_int_vector_mask : d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_int_vector_mask : int_vec= 12, int_mask= 12
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0 Testing Device Number 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0
BOXG_get_pp_info - ENTRY : dev_num= 0, unit_idx=0, slot_idx= 0
BOXP_get_pp_list - BOXP_get_slot_info: NOT NULL slot_PTR
BOXP_get_pp_list - num_of_PP_obj > 0 = OK
BOXP_get_pp_list - return pp_PTR - for dev_num= 0 01-Jan-2000 01:01:25 %2SWINIT-F-INITPORTLIB: SW2C_dist_new_master_id:: Port lib init failed
Reporting Task: ROOT.
Software Version: 1.0.0.47 (date 02-Nov-2005 time 09:53:18)
blue-dot
13 Posts
0
October 10th, 2006 12:00
vista_joe
1 Message
0
June 23rd, 2008 23:00
Still no solution to this issue? I have a 5324 with the same exact problem.
madtroll
1 Message
0
October 21st, 2009 07:00
I have the same problem.
I tried to alter already all firmwares.
Deleted a configuration and erased all areas of flash.
Same result ...
I am already tired.
What to do further? :emotion-6: